✦ Synopsis
The conformational transitions lead to reorientations of a small fraction only of a chain molecule. This follows from the analysis of the barrier crossing problem according to the Framers theory. Therefore, the librational motion operating after a transition is responsible for the attainment of the new equilibrium distribution. A simplified treatment is presented for the model system of an infinite chain of rotors. It is shown that the reorientations of the chain units induced by a conformational transition, propagate along the chain with increasing time delays. T'his constitutes an effective mechanism of coupling between the librational motion and the conformational dynamics in long chain molecules.
